Messages Confirming Identity or content

 

 

 

These messages are from spirits who wish to assure Padgett that the previous spirit who wrote was who it claimed to be. Or they confirm that the content of a message is accurate and should be believed, even if it seems to contradict previous beliefs.

 

 

14-15 September 1914: Ann Rollins: Mr. Padgett's grandmother, a Celestial Spirit, reassures Padgett that it was truly Jesus of the Scriptures that spoke and wrote to him a few days previously.
